Lehigh Valley IronPigs News Release


The first-place IronPigs (61-39) play Game 2 of a three-game series against the Gwinnett Stripers (47-54) at Coca-Cola Park... With a 6-5, come-from-behind victory last night, the Pigs have won four-consecutive games overall as well as four-straight against Gwinnett. In addition, the Pigs set a season high-water mark of 22 games above .500 while increasing their lead to a franchise-record, 8.0-games in the North. Lehigh Valley has also won 13 of its last 16 contests and owns a 32-13 record since June 3... The Stripers -- Atlanta's top affiliate -- snapped their three-game winning streak. Still, the red-hot Stripers have won eight of their last 10 affairs and are 12-4 after falling to a season low-water mark of 35-50 on July 4.

RHP Tom Eshelman (1-8, 6.16) will start for LHV against RHP Touki Toussaint (1-0, 2.92).

Today is Camp Day. First-Pitch is at 11:35 a.m.
